Women's Soccer Wins First Conference Game with a Clean Sheet

HOW IT HAPPENED
  • Nebraska Wesleyan put down a clean sheet against Buena Vista University, winning 3-0 on home turf. 
  • Both teams remained scoreless for a majority of the first period. Freshman Averie Hike put an end to the drought and scored the first goal in the forty-second minute with the help of Kaeding Rassfeld
  • In the fifty-fifth minute, Aniaya Reed and Amanda Olivas each recorded a goal off of an assist from the other. This cemented the win for the Black and Gold, giving them their first conference win of the season.
  • Jena Schultz started as goalie for the P-Wolves. She saved one goal and stayed in for 68 minutes before switching with Catthi Pham, who finished out the game and recorded one save of her own.
